How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Stinesville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Stinesville Studio Apartments | $1,189 | $649 | $1,659 |
| Stinesville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,460 | $725 | $2,247 |
| Stinesville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,574 | $825 | $3,066 |
| Stinesville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,792 | $835 | $3,300 |
| Stinesville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,329 | $699 | $4,400 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Stinesville Apartments with Hardwood Floors
What is the Cheapest Hardwood Floors apartment in Stinesville?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Stinesville with Hardwood Floors is at The Bleachers listed at $800.
How much is the average rent for Stinesville Apartments with Hardwood Floors?
The average rent for a Apartment in Stinesville with Hardwood Floors is $1,486.
What is the largest Stinesville Apartment for rent with Hardwood Floors?
Today's Apartment with Hardwood Floors and the most square footage in Stinesville is a 2,046 square feet unit starting from $1,790 at Abodes Downtown (Franklin Apts).
What is the average size for Stinesville Apartments for rent with Hardwood Floors?
The average size for a rental with Hardwood Floors in Stinesville is currently at 798 sq ft.
